Product details

Guard locking — holds the door shut until the safety circuit releases it

The D4SLN4EFADN is a guard lock safety-door switch from Omron's D4SL series. Unlike a basic interlock that only detects the door position, this switch physically locks the guard door closed until the machine controller de-energizes the lock solenoid — preventing access while hazardous motion is still coasting down. The contact configuration is 2 normally-open and 3 normally-closed (2NO/3NC). The NC contacts are the safety-rated channel wired into the safety relay or PLC safety input; the NO contacts signal door-locked status back to the standard control logic.

IP67 and connector termination — built for washdown zones

Rated IP67, the switch body and the connector interface withstand hose-directed water and dust ingress — suitable for food processing, beverage lines, or any area where the guard sees periodic washdown. Termination is via a connector, not a hardwired pigtail. The mating cordset (typically an M12 or similar industrial connector) must be ordered separately; the connector style is not specified here, so confirm the pinout and cordset part number against the machine wiring diagram before ordering.

Switching limits and cycle life — signal-level duty, not power switching

The contacts are rated for 1.5 A at 120 V AC and 220 mA at 125 V DC. This is a signal-level switch feeding a safety PLC or relay input — it is not designed to break motor currents or solenoid loads directly. If the load exceeds these limits, an interposing safety relay or contactor must be used. Electrical life is 150,000 cycles; mechanical life is 1 million cycles. On a high-cycle door (e.g., a packaging machine that opens and closes every 30 seconds), the electrical life is reached in about 1,250 hours of operation — budget a replacement interval accordingly.

Physical fit — 39 mm square body, 155 mm tall

The switch body measures 39 mm wide by 39 mm deep by 155 mm tall. The 39 mm square cross-section fits standard 40 mm panel cutouts; the 155 mm height is the dimension that determines enclosure clearance — ensure the guard frame or enclosure has at least 160 mm of vertical space for the switch body and actuator key travel. The actuator is a key type, and the head can be oriented in four directions — top, bottom, left, or right entry — giving flexibility for different door hinge configurations without changing the switch body.

Frequently asked questions

What is the contact configuration on the D4SLN4EFADN?

The switch has 2 normally-open and 3 normally-closed contacts (2NO/3NC). The three NC contacts are the safety-rated channel; the two NO contacts provide door-locked status feedback to the control system.

What is the IP rating and where can this switch be used?

The D4SLN4EFADN is rated IP67, meaning it is dust-tight and protected against temporary immersion in water. It is suitable for washdown environments such as food processing, beverage, or pharmaceutical lines where the guard door sees periodic hose-down cleaning.

What are the switching current limits for this safety switch?

The contacts are rated for 1.5 A at 120 V AC and 220 mA at 125 V DC. This is a signal-level switch for safety PLC or relay inputs — it cannot directly break motor or solenoid loads. Use an interposing safety relay or contactor for higher current loads.
